Dogs I am very comfortable looking after dogs of all sizes and I'm familiar with positive-reinforcement training techniques so I'm happy to continue any ongoing training with your dog. When I am house-sitting, I like to take dogs out for at least 2 walks a day, and depending on the dog's needs and recall ability I endeavour to take them to local dog parks for a run-around and play. I regularly ensure water bowls are topped up, especially in hot weather, and will work alongside the owner to maintain a desired feeding/treat schedule depending on your preferences. In the house, I like to play tug, fetch and enrichment games with dogs to keep them occupied, and of course lots of love and cuddles if the dog prefers it! I offer house sitting, drop-in sessions and dog walking. Cats Like with dogs, cats come with all sorts of different personalities! I believe cats require a more gentle and subdued approach than with most dogs (unless the dog is nervous), allowing them to come up to you in their own time rather than approaching them. I offer drop-in sessions and overnight sitting. Rabbits I understand a rabbit's physiological need to be constantly eating, which is why I will always ensure they have more than enough hay to eat. I will feed your rabbit, top up their water and offer them company, letting them out of their hutch into a secure area to run around if necessary. I offer drop-in sessions and overnight sitting.
